The Evolution Of Apple’S Earbuds

Apple’s earbuds have undergone a significant evolution since their introduction in 2001. Initially released as part of the first-generation iPod, these wired earbuds have continued to evolve with each new iteration of Apple’s devices. The most notable transformation came with the launch of the AirPods in 2016, which marked a shift towards wireless earbuds and a departure from the traditional wired design.

The transition from the classic wired earbuds to the wireless AirPods represented a groundbreaking shift in Apple’s audio technology. The move signified a shift in consumer preferences towards wireless, hassle-free audio experiences. With improvements in Bluetooth connectivity and battery life, the AirPods set a new standard for convenience and mobility in the audio accessory market.

Despite the shift towards wireless technology, Apple continues to offer its classic wired earbuds alongside its wireless options, catering to different user preferences. The evolution of Apple’s earbuds reflects the company’s commitment to innovation and its ability to adapt to changing consumer needs, while also providing users with a variety of audio solutions.

The Controversy Of Wired Vs. Wireless

The controversy surrounding wired versus wireless earbuds has been a hot topic of discussion among tech enthusiasts and consumers alike. While wireless earbuds offer the convenience of a tangle-free experience and greater mobility, the debate remains heated on whether they can truly match the sound quality and reliability of their wired counterparts. Many audiophiles argue that wired earbuds still deliver superior sound fidelity, making them preferable for serious music enthusiasts and professionals.

On the other hand, proponents of wireless earbuds highlight the freedom they provide, emphasizing the elimination of cumbersome cables and the ability to move around without being tethered to a device. The convenience of wireless connectivity, particularly in the age of increasingly scarce audio jack ports on smartphones, is also a significant factor that sways many consumers towards adopting wireless options. As technology continues to advance, the gap between wired and wireless earbuds in terms of sound quality and reliability is narrowing, leaving consumers to weigh the benefits of each and make a choice based on their individual preferences and needs.

User Experience And Comfort

In terms of user experience, Apple’s wired earbuds have garnered mixed reviews. While some users find them comfortable and well-designed, others have complained about their fit and bulkiness. The earbuds come with a one-size-fits-all design, which may not be suitable for all users, particularly those with smaller ears. Additionally, the wired nature of the earbuds can sometimes lead to tangling issues, which can be frustrating for users on the go.

On the positive side, many users appreciate the simplicity and ease of use of the Apple wired earbuds. The inline remote and microphone offer convenient control and clear audio during phone calls. However, some users have reported discomfort during extended use, particularly when engaging in physical activities. It’s important to note that individual preferences and ear shapes play a significant role in determining the comfort level of these earbuds.

Overall, the user experience and comfort level of Apple’s wired earbuds may vary from person to person. While some users may find them comfortable and intuitive, others may encounter fit and comfort issues. It’s crucial for potential buyers to consider their own preferences and requirements before making a decision.

Durability And Longevity Of Wired Earbuds

When it comes to the durability and longevity of Apple wired earbuds, there have been mixed reviews from users and experts. Many users have reported issues with the longevity of the earbuds, with some experiencing fraying of the wires and deterioration of the earpiece over time. This has led to concerns about the overall durability of the product and its ability to withstand regular wear and tear.

Given the delicate nature of the wiring and the potential for wear and tear with frequent use, some users have found that the lifespan of Apple wired earbuds falls short of expectations. However, it’s important to note that proper care and maintenance can significantly impact the durability of the earbuds. Simple practices such as storing the earbuds in a protective case when not in use and avoiding excessive bending or pulling of the wires can help extend their lifespan.

In conclusion, while Apple wired earbuds have received criticism for their durability and longevity, taking care of them can prolong their lifespan. Users should be mindful of how they handle and store the earbuds to ensure they continue to provide reliable performance over time.
